It looks at the … WebThe net addition of water to alkenes is known as hydration. The result involves breaking the pi bond in the alkene and an OH bond in water and the formation of a C-H bond and a C-OH bond. The reaction is typically exothermic by 10 - 15 kcal/mol, 1 but has an entropy change of -35 - -40 cal/mol K.

Technical Report(s): 1995 TAP; 2014 TR - Ethanol; 2014 TR - Isopropanol Petition(s): N/A Past NOSB Actions: 10/1995 NOSB minutes and vote; 11/2005 NOSB sunset recommendation; 04/2011 … schematic diagram biologyWeb28 dec. 2024 · The hydration of ethene to make ethanol. A reminder of the facts. Ethene is mixed with steam and passed over a catalyst consisting of solid silicon dioxide coated with phosphoric(V) acid.
